    Viewing angle is ok side to side, vertical is not good. It's bad when screen is tilted toward you, get washed out when you overlook it but its very good when u tilt it back. Pretty much face to face with it is fine.

    It's approximately in the same quality as the R2 screen. I see your signature has a macbook pro. When comparing R3 screen to Macbook pro, there is no comparison, macbook pro excel it by a wide margin. However as one editor said, there's simply not many maker making 11.6 in out there so it's decent relative to its lack of choice and compare with R1 R2 I owned.

    Contrast ratio is same as R2 and R1. Macbook pro still beats it by quite a bit but it's not bad by any means.

    I remember that crazy r1 fan......just like my ex's temper :D

    When doing browsing and movie and youtube, its either completely silent or fan come on sometimes and off, but still quiet like R2. It does not have the crazy R1 behavior.

    However when you play game or run vantage like I'm doing now the fan is nuts..constant loud like hair dryer. But it quiets down as soon as you quit game.

    The service manual for the M11x r3 shows one exactly like the Dell Wireless 365:
    http://support.dell.com/support/edocs/systems/Alw_M11xR3/en/SM/btboard.htm#wp1213253

    The DW375 attaches with a cable instead of a built-in connector. Can anyone take a look to tell for sure? They might've just copy/pasted that part of the manual from the previous model!

    Edit: It uses the cable for sure, even in an m11x r3. Getting an adapter with the right cable was proving difficult but I discovered that the cable was already present in the notebook even though the adapter wasn't. I had to take it apart myself to find out though because the tear-downs all had BT adapters. :)
